Day 2 (13 Dec 2014): Berjaya Times Square (Indoor) Theme Park


After Sunway Lagoon, we proceeded to Berjaya Times Square for its indoor theme park in the evening.

The theme park spans 2 levels, 5th and 7th. I suppose the 6th level is occupied by the intimidating roller coaster and other thrill rides and that's why it is missing. The 5th level features rides for older kids and adults while the 7th is for young kids.

As we did before, we used MyKad to pay for the family package of 2A2C and 1 Senior (RM 121 in all). And off we went to the 7th level while Coco remained at the 5th to explore her heart-stopping rides.

We spent less than 2 hours in the theme park and had time to do some rides twice or thrice before it closed. I like the fact that the theme park is very suitable for small kids. There are 7 rides in all, if I remember correctly, so kids would really have a good time here. If I ever go back to KL again, it's likely that I take Baby there again.


Berjaya Times Square Theme Park
Level 5 & 7
Berjaya Times Square,
No. 1, Jalan Imbi, 55100 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ia

Opening hours
Monday to Friday - 12pm to 10pm
Weekends/Public holidays and school holidays - 11am to 10pm

Ticketing information
Adult (13 yrs and above) - RM 48
Child (3 to 12 yrs) - RM 38
Family rides (Level 7 only) - RM 25
Family package (2A2C) - RM 138
Senior (55 yrs and above) - RM 15
Special/Handicapped - RM10
Infant (Below 3 yrs) - Free

MyKad holders
Adult (13 yrs and above) - RM 38
Child (3 to 12 yrs) - RM 28
Family package (2A2C) - RM 106
